Salary
The US Bureau of Labour Statistics classifies the employment positions covered by CASP+ as computer network architects. The number of employment in this category is predicted to increase by more than 6% by 2026, with a typical salary of $104,650 in 2022.

What is the minimum score required to pass CASP+?
Candidates will only be informed of their status as passed or failed because there is no predetermined % for a passing score. CompTIA will send you a congratulations email if you pass the exam. The given score report indicates the test sections you did well on.
What is exam format?
- Count of Questions 90 questions maximum
- Question Types
- Multiple-choice and performance-based assessments
- Test duration: 165 minutes
- Passing Grade
- This test does not have a scaled score; it is solely pass/fail.
Candidates who initially fail the test are given a 24-hour window in which to retake it. (CompTIA doesn't require a waiting period). When taking the test a third time, students must wait 14 calendar days if they fail it the first two times.
